California tax-deed county. Mendocino County Treasurer-Tax Collector tax-defaulted property auction: no tentative next auction date as of mid-2026 research; prerequisite work underway. Impending Power to Sell notices mailed February 28, 2026; if not redeemed or on payment plan by June 30, 2026, Power to Sell recorded July 1, 2026 and parcels become eligible for sale. Historical auctions used Bid4Assets (e.g. June 2019). COVID/staffing gaps meant no public auctions in 2020–2021. Confirm platform and list when posted.
